#b92033 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b92033 is composed of 72.5% red, 12.5%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.7% magenta, 72.4%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 352.5 degrees, a saturation of 70.5% and a lightness of 42.5%. #b92033 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4066 with #730000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#b92033

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fceff1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b92033

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6b6b is the less saturated color, while #d20720 is the most saturated one.
